Salt Composition

Chlorpheniramine Maleate (2mg) + Paracetamol (250mg) + Phenylephrine (5mg)

Overview Sinatic DS Syrup

Cold symptoms find relief in the formulation of Sinatic DS Syrup. This medication addresses headache, sore throat, nasal congestion, muscle aches, and fever. Sinatic DS Syrup may be administered with or without food; dosage and treatment length are determined by symptom severity. Continue the prescribed course even with symptom improvement, ceasing only upon your physician's recommendation. Minor side effects, including nausea, vomiting, drowsiness, dizziness, and headache, may occur. Persistent or worsening side effects warrant immediate medical attention; your doctor can offer strategies for mitigation. Minimize usage to effectively manage symptoms. Prior to commencing treatment, inform your doctor of any existing health issues, medications, liver or kidney problems. Alcohol consumption should be avoided during treatment due to potential side effect exacerbation.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als must seek medical counsel before using this medication.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Consuming alcohol alongside Sinatic DS Syrup poses a safety risk.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Use of Sinatic DS Syrup during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the risks and benefits pr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ice before use.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Lactation and Sinatic DS Syrup appear compatible. Available human data indicate minimal infant risk associated with maternal use.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Driving should be avoided if you experience drowsiness, blurred vision, or dizziness after taking Sinatic DS Syrup, as these are potential side effects.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Sinatic DS Syrup appears safe for individuals with kidney disease; available evidence indicates dose modification may be unnecessary. However, physician consultation is recommended. Patients with advanced kidney failure may experience increased drowsiness while taking Sinatic DS Syrup.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with hepatic impairment should use Sinatic DS Syrup judiciously; d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Sinatic DS Syrup :

Should you forget a Sinatic DS Syrup dose, administer it promptly.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ed one and resume your usual dosing regimen. Never take a double dose.

FAQs on Sinatic DS Syrup

Sinatic DS Syrup combines chlorpheniramine, paracetamol (acetaminophen), and phenylephrine to alleviate cold symptoms such as runny nose, watery eyes, fever, and headache. Chlorpheniramine, an antihistamine, targets allergy symptoms including runny nose, watery eyes, and sneezing. Paracetamol reduces fever and pain by blocking pain- and fever-causing chemicals in the brain. Phenylephrine, a decongestant, shrinks blood vessels to relieve nasal congestion.
Sinatic DS Syrup is generally safe, but may cause side effects such as nausea, vomiting, allergic reactions, sleepiness, or headache in some individuals. Less common side effects are also possible. Report any persistent issues to your doctor.
Sinatic DS Syrup is typically prescribed for short-term use, ceasing once symptoms improve. However, follow your doctor's instructions regarding continued use.
Dizziness, including lightheadedness and faintness, is a possible side effect of Sinatic DS Syrup. Should you experience this, rest until symptoms subside before resuming activities.
Sinatic DS Syrup is generally safe at the recommended dosage. Excessive consumption, however, can harm the liver. Alcohol should be avoided while using this medication to minimize the risk of liver damage.
Store this medication in its original, tightly closed container as directed on the label. Discard any unused medication and ensure it's inaccessible to children, pets, and others.
